Percentage of enrolment in pre-primary education in private in New Zealand
New Zealand: Percentage of enrolment in pre-primary education in private was 98.7% in 2018. ▬ Flat
Percentage of enrolment in pre-primary education in private in New Zealand, 2014–2018
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2018, percentage of enrolment in pre-primary education in private in New Zealand stood at 98.7%. That is the highest value across all 5 years on record.
The figure is up 0.4% over five years.
That places New Zealand 10th out of 195 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the top 10%.

New Zealand compared with similar countries
- New Zealand's 98.7% is above the median for high income countries, which is 29.0%, 3.4× the median. (76 countries reporting)
- New Zealand's 98.7% is above the median for East Asia & Pacific, which is 36.1%, 2.7× the median. (32 countries reporting)

About this data
Total number of students in pre-primary education enrolled in institutions that are not operated by a public authority but controlled and managed, whether for profit or not, by a private body (e.g., non-governmental organisation, religious body, special interest group, foundation or business enterprise), expressed as a percentage of total number of students enrolled in pre-primary education. Within ISCED 0, early childhood educational development programmes are targeted at children aged 0 to 2 years; and pre-primary education programmes are targeted at children aged 3 years until the age to start ISCED 1.
